To secure an entry-level position, candidates should have a B.S. in electrical engineering, or an equivalent degree.

Although many entry-level jobs in electrical engineering do not require a Master’s degree, there are some prerequisites that you must meet to be able to get one. An undergraduate degree in either electrical engineering or computer engineering is required. Also, you will need to pass NCEES Fundamentals of Engineering. This exam is also known as Engineer in Training or Engineering Intern. The NCEES Fundamentals of Engineering exam is required to earn a PE License. It's not uncommon for entry-level electrical engineers to work under a licensed engineer for four years.

Internships are a great way to get an entry-level job in electrical engineering once you have graduated from school. Many engineering students get involved in internships as early as their sophomore year. These programs, which last for 10 weeks, are meant to get students familiar with the industry. Not only do these internships give students experience before committing to a full-time position, they help companies evaluate future employees. Employers want to hire the best so internships are a great way of getting into the field.

What is an Aerospace Engineer?

Aerospace engineers draw on their expertise in aeronautics as well as propulsion, robotics and flight dynamics when designing aircraft, spacecrafts satellites, rockets, missiles, and other spacecraft.

An aerospace engineer may be involved in designing new aircraft types, developing new fuel sources, improving existing engines, or creating space suits.

What are the jobs of electrical engineers?

They design power systems for use by people.

They are responsible for the design, construction, testing, installation, maintenance, and repair of all types electric equipment used in industry, government, and commercial customers.

They also plan, direct, and coordinate the installation of these system, which may include coordination with other trades such architects, contractors and plumbers.

Electrical engineers design and install electronic devices, circuits, and components that convert electricity into useful forms.


What is a Mechanical Engineer?

A mechanical engineer designs machines for people, such as vehicles, tools, products and machinery.

The engineering principles of mathematics, physics, as well as engineering principles, are used by mechanical engineers to solve real-world problems.

A mechanical engineer could be involved with product development, maintenance, quality control and research.


What is Engineering?

Engineering can be described as the application and production of useful things using scientific principles. Engineers use science and mathematics to create and construct machines, buildings, bridges or aircraft, and also robots, tools and structures.

Engineers may be involved in research and development, production, maintenance, testing, quality control, sales, marketing, management, teaching, consulting, law, politics, finance, human resources, administration, and many other areas.

Engineers have many responsibilities. They can design and build products, systems and processes; manage projects; perform tests and inspections; analyze data; create models; write specifications; develop standards; train employees, supervise workers and make decisions.

Engineers may specialize in certain areas, including mechanical, electrical and chemical.

Some engineers choose to focus on specific types of engineering, such as aeronautics, biotechnology, chemistry, computing, electronics, energy, industrial, marine, medicine, military, nuclear, robotics, space, transportation, telecommunications, and water.
